public abstract class Datum extends Object implements Serializable
Each subclass represents one of the native kernel datatypes.
In order to allow for possible optimization of data copying between SQL and Java, instances of subclasses are immutable.

- byte array used to set the datum valuepublic byte[] getBytes()
For now, the data array is simply copied. When we are using moss to go directly to the buffer cache, this implementation will be overridden by a native method which will cons an array and copy the bytes into it.
Subclasses which handle very long datatypes which will not ordinarily be represented as Java array, should check for allocation failure and return nil if detected. They should however try to materialize the raw data no matter how long since users may actually need to materialize huge arrays.
